What is an Ophelia credit?
Ophelia credits are the virtual currency that is used in this community. 1 credit is worth $1.56 USD. Community members can purchase credits and attach them to their tickets and Ophelia Pros can earn credits by answering tickets. Also, just to be clear, these credits have nothing to do with Web3, blockchain or cryptocurrency.

Are tickets private?
Yes. Only Ophelia Pros can see all open tickets. Community members can only see their own tickets.
Can I get a refund?
We do not provide cash refunds for purchased Ophelia credits. However, you can get refunds of your Ophelia credits if you feel that a ticket wasn't handled correctly. Just "Flag" a ticket and our team will look into the issue wtihin 24 to 48 hours.
Why introduce a virtual currency?
Virtual credits are easier to refund  than money. Plus, with credits you can do more things with it. For example, right now in Ophelia you can gift credits to a friend.In the future, I'll be doing more with credits that'll add more value to the site. Like the ability to convert credits into monthly raffle tickets for giveaways. As for the price, I started with $1 per credit. Then added on Stripe fees, taxes and overhead. This is how i got to $1.56/credit.

What's the difference between Ophelia and Freelance job boards?
Ophelia is a platform that helps freelancers get through their current projects. Ophelia Pros help answer their unique questions, so they don't have to waste time searching through forums, Discord, or social media.
Other project boards, like Contra, Fiverr, and Upwork, are focused on helping freelancers find new projects. Ophelia is different because Ophelia Pros are here to help you with the projects you already have.

Are there any fees for Ophelia Pros?
The platform will take 5% of each cash out from Ophelia Pros to help cover overhead fees. The minimum amount an Ophelia Pro can earn is $23.75 per ticket.
